The 8 Sessions.. Recap. Met first, decided on bowling. Bowling session and videos. Sat down and analysed. Reduce the bound. Arms pumping. Arm pathways. Knee drive. Lots of drills. Progressed them. Full run up eventually. Video analysis stuck on wall! Found the video very helpful.
Thought it was a success. Loved seeing herself bowl. Knew what to work on.
Bound. Jumped over small cone. Simple. First effort worked. Biggest change, and was made in 20 minutes. Once she understood she changed everything. I agree. Nothing she struggled with for more than a session.
Wanted to establish herself on sides, more overs and more consistent. Main goal was get faster. She thinks she got a little faster, but wants to increase it more. Increase of speed was as good as it gets over an 8 week period.
